@import "CTLine.j"
kCTFrameProgressionTopToBottom = 0;
kCTFrameProgressionRightToLeft = 1;
kCTFrameProgressionAttributeName = @"kCTFrameProgressionAttributeName";
function _CTFrameCreate(aPath, attributes, lines, attributedString)
{
return {
path: aPath,
attributes: attributes,
lines: lines,
string: attributedString
};
}
_CTFrameCreate.displayName = @"_CTFrameCreate";
// Returns a CPRange
function CTFrameGetStringRange(/* CTFrame */ aFrame)
{
return CPMakeRange();
}
CTFrameGetStringRange.displayName = @"CTFrameGetStringRange";
// Returns a CPRange
function CTFrameGetVisibleStringRange(/* CTFrame */ aFrame)
{
return CPMakeRange();
}
CTFrameGetVisibleStringRange.displayName = @"CTFrameGetVisibleStringRange";
// Returns a CGPath
function CTFrameGetPath(/* CTFrame */ aFrame)
{
return aFrame.path;
}
CTFrameGetPath.displayName = @"CTFrameGetPath";
// Returns a CPDictionary
function CTFrameGetFrameAttributes(/* CTFrame */ aFrame)
{
return aFrame.frameAttributes;
}
CTFrameGetFrameAttributes.displayName = @"CTFrameGetFrameAttributes";
// Returns an array of CTLines
function CTFrameGetLines(/* CTFrame */ aFrame)
{
return aFrame.lines;
}
CTFrameGetLines.displayName = @"CTFrameGetLines";
// Returns an array of CGPoints
function CTFrameGetLineOrigins(/* CTFrame */ aFrame, /* CPRange */ aRange)
{
var results = [],
lines = aRange ? CTFrameGetLinesForRange(aFrame, aRange) : aFrame.lines;
for (var i = -1, count = lines.length; ++i < count;)
results.push(lines[i].origin);
return results;
}
CTFrameGetLineOrigins.displayName = @"CTFrameGetLineOrigins";
// Returns an array of CTLines
// Divergent from Cocoa and expensive.
function CTFrameGetLinesForRange(/* CTFrame */ aFrame, /* CPRange */ lhs)
{
var lines = aFrame.lines, results = [];
for (var i = -1, count = lines.length; ++i < count;)
{
var line = lines[i],
rhs = CTLineGetStringRange(line);
if ((CPMaxRange(lhs) < rhs.location || CPMaxRange(rhs) < lhs.location) && result.length)
break;
if (lhs.location >= rhs.location && rhs.location <= CPMaxRange(lhs) && CPMaxRange(rhs) > lhs.location)
results.push(line);
}
return results;
}
CTFrameGetLinesForRange.displayName = @"CTFrameGetLinesForRange";
// Returns a CPRange
// This is divergent from Cocoa. It's a convenience method used in CPTextView.
function CTFrameGetRangeForPoint(/* CTFrame */ aFrame, /* CGPoint */ aPoint)
{
var lines = aFrame.lines, y = aPoint.y;
for (var i = -1, count = lines.length; ++i < count;)
{
var line = lines[i],
bounds = CTLineGetImageBounds(line),
lineY = line._startPosition.y;
if (y >= lineY && y < bounds.size.height + lineY)
{
// FIXME: we seem to be doing stuff like this with some frequency;
// Maybe it should be normalized at an earlier point.
var index = CTLineGetStringIndexForPosition(line, aPoint),
range = CTLineGetStringRange(line);
range.location += index;
range.length = 0;
return range;
}
}
}
CTFrameGetRangeForPoint.displayName = @"CTFrameGetRangeForPoint";
function CTFrameDraw(/* CTFrame */ aFrame, /* CGContext */ aContext)
{
var origin = aFrame.path.start,
lines = aFrame.lines;
CGContextSetTextPosition(aContext, origin.x, origin.y);
for (var i = -1, count = lines.length; ++i < count;)
{
var line = lines[i],
alignment = [line.string attribute:@"alignment" atIndex:0 effectiveRange:CPMakeRange(0, 0)],
position = CGContextGetTextPosition(aContext);
if (alignment === CPRightTextAlignment)
line.origin = CGPointMake((aFrame.path.elements[1].x - origin.x * 2) - CTLineGetTypographicBounds(line).width, position.y);
else if (alignment === CPCenterTextAlignment)
line.origin = CGPointMake(((aFrame.path.elements[1].x - origin.x) / 2) - CTLineGetTypographicBounds(line).width / 2, position.y);
else
line.origin = CGPointMake(origin.x, position.y);
CGContextSetTextPosition(aContext, line.origin.x, line.origin.y);
CTLineDraw(line, aContext);
}
}
CTFrameDraw.displayName = @"CTFrameDraw";
